Name: Victoria Nicholson

Age: Not known, though she is somewhere over 100
Species: Vampire

Looks: 
Victoria is an average-tall woman, though she is a little more muscular and thin than normal. Victoria has absolutely no color in any part of her outer body. Her skin and her hair are both completely snow white. The exception is her eyes, which are a normal vampire Crimson. Victoria loves to wear clothes in red, black and white. She normally wears a large red coat with no sleeves but a high collar. She also wears a black tank top with a white zipper down the front, and she wears a black pleated skirt. She has white, thigh high socks, and black knee-high boots that zip up in the front. Victoria has fingerless, elbow long black gloves, two belts around her stomach, a white bow around her coat's collar, and she wears an old cross on a string. There are black swirls all over her coat, and these swirls are in constant differing patterns...

Personality: 
Victoria is a cocky asshole, to sum most of that up. She is, however, very very strong, so her boasts are warranted. She has a large love for murder and the act of murdering, because at this point in her life, it's one of the only things that gives her joy. It's one of the only things that reminds her of mortality, which is a thing that she wishes she had. Victoria, besides being a bat-shit insane, cocky asshole, has a very sensitive spot for a select few humans, though it's not something she lets people know of, ever. She wishes so much to be human, that it's mostly the reason she hates them so much too. Although Victoria is very strong and likes to murder, she's more fond of being seductive, being a tease, and being very very lazy. In fact, those three things are her favorite pass times. Victoria's flirty and lazy exterior is how she is most times, but there are times where she can be annoyed, or even angry, if pushed far enough. Sometimes she's even in depressed, sad moods, where she's had something remind her of her past, or how much she wishes she was not what she is. 

Past: 
Victoria grew up without a father, and had to constantly care for her sick mother. But that was alright for Victoria. She didn't mind. Her mother was all she needed in her life. As a child, Victoria was happy, sweet, and carefree. But soon, tragedy struck her life. Her mother died suddenly, and Victoria was left alone, though she quickly attracted attention of the unwanted kind. She started living on the streets, and one night, while on the way to a friend's house, a mysterious figure appeared to her, clad in a trench coat and top hat. He was always smiling, and referred to himself as 'The Collector'. The man informed Victoria that she was now part of his 'collection'. Victoria sensed stranger danger, and tried to escape, but the mysterious man was of the undead kind, and he was quick to over take her, and end her mortal life. Victoria spent the next number of decades as a prisoner in a pompous mansion. She was always in fancy clothes and accessories, had servants to tend to her, along with other girls and boys who were part of the man's collection. She was never happy though. She was appalled and disgusted by what she had become. She refused to drink any sort of human blood, usually surviving on small amounts of animal blood. The favorite of the collection, a girl named Amelia, always tried to help out Victoria, and the two became very close. However, at some point, Victoria 'broke' a few people in the collection, having gone half mad from starvation and anger. Just before Victoria was sealed in the basement as punishment, Amelia handed Victoria a vial of blood. The vial was about as big as a stick of deodorant. Victoria was not allowed to drink this blood until 'the right time'. So, when Victoria was sealed in the basement, knowing that she'd never see Amelia again, since Amelia was planning to 'break' herself, Victoria hid the vial behind her head, under her hair ribbon, and she sat there on the floor fighting her cravings and insanity for a good number of decades, slowly shriveling into nothing but a corpse. When the Collector finally checked on her, it was clear that he was losing himself. He was violent, unstable, and very eager to blame his problems on Victoria, even though she was a body. Nothing more. In a fit of anger, the Collector beat Victoria's face, smashing her head against the wall, where the vial of blood smashed open, and leaked blood everywhere. The blood was very quickly absorbed into Victoria's corpse, and her body started to come back all at once. Having drained the last bit of Amelia's blood, the color in Victoria's body also drained, except for her eyes, which became a bloody red. Having finally drank blood from a 'human being', Victoria reached full vampire status, and with the last bit of her vengeful, and spiteful mortality, she created herself a 'shadow' without really knowing it. Victoria was very powerful to start with, but was a little too powerful, as she had no clue how to control her vampire powers fully. After easily disposing of the Collector, Victoria also killed every last 'collection' piece, and drained them all of their blood. When she was finished at that mansion, she left in the night, leaving the place of her life's misery and torment in flames. After some time in hiding, Victoria figured out how to control her 'shadow', and started her work as a bounty hunter, very quickly becoming good at her job, where she made a reputation for herself among the dark parts of society. She earned the nickname 'The Shadow Vampire' because of her ease of phasing into nothingness, and because of her unique 'shadow'. Although her new life as a vampire was something special and wonderful, Victoria still loathed herself, always feeling regret and remorse for what happened at the mansion all those years ago.

Abilities: Victoria has all the normal abilities of a vampire. Regeneration, super speed and strength, telepathy, limited mind control, limited levitation, and the ability to phase in and out of solid objects. However, Victoria has a unique power she obtained through unknown means. The swirls on her coat are actually part of her. Victoria is nicknamed 'The Shadow Vampire' because of her strange 'shadow'. This shadow has been with her since her creation, and has not went away since. The shadow, much like Alucard's dogs, is a thing Victoria does not use unless absolutely necessary. The shadow allows Victoria to exceed her normal capabilities, although the shadow tends to 'burn' her away if she uses it for too long. As well as Victoria herself, the shadow can fight on it's own, shaping itself into many different forms depending on Victoria's opponent. When the Shadow is not being used, it slides up Victoria's spine, making it look like a back tattoo, and slides itself along whatever clothes she's wearing, making itself look like a pattern.

Weapon:
Victoria wields a pair of .500 S&W Magnum handguns, which are considered to be the most powerful commercial sporting handguns by the amount of energy it creates in it's muzzle. Each gun has been 'altered' slightly, so each gun can fire with nothing held back. The bullets in her guns are encased in silver, as she prefers a struggle, rather than a quick 'boom' from an explosive shell. She does, however, keep them around, just in case she finds herself in need of them. Victoria stores her guns in the back of her belts, in a way that's quick to draw them.

Extra:
-The cross around her neck is made of polished stone, so no harm comes to her by wearing it.    
-Victoria's 'Shadow' is not a person she devoured, or controlled by anything she killed. Her 'Shadow' is the remnants of her mortal self. When she became a full-fledged vampire, her mortality left her, and by her resentment and anger, it became her 'Shadow'. Like an angry poltergeist or something as such. If the 'Shadow' is somehow disconnected from Victoria, Victoria starts to receive large amounts of pain and damage. If the 'Shadow' is destroyed completely, then Victoria dies.
